4. Meta Platforms, Inc. (NASDAQ:META)

Number of Hedge Fund Holders In Q1 2025: 273

Meta Platforms, Inc. (NASDAQ:META) has become a regular feature of Cramer’s morning show due to the firm’s AI initiatives. Cramer believes that the firm has to improve its AI model performance. This time, he criticized Meta Platforms, Inc. (NASDAQ:META)’s strategy of marketing its AI investments:

“[On Zuckerberg’s data center announcements] Now here’s what these companies are all doing wrong. They’re appealing to the wrong people. They are not, I mean there’s a big scrum going on among all these. And they just don’t talk about what regular people want. I mean Zuckerberg should be saying, look wanna look up something about what is important right now in the world? You come to ours. But they don’t want to appeal to the people. They try to appeal to Wall Street. Well come on, we don’t know. I mean we don’t know anything. I mean where’s Gemini. What can Gemini do that I can’t get from Perplexity? Give me the list, the bill of particulars about why I should go to Claude.
